Story

As a trade unionist, I am not someone who believes that 'charity' is an alternative for proper funding of public services. However, when my friend and colleague, Lawrence Stevens, Lewisham NUT Treasurer, suffered a serious heart attack during the weekend of NUT Conference, I thought it was only right to use this opportunity to ask for support for the British Heart Foundation, the sponsor of the London-Brighton ride that I am taking part in on Sunday, June 15th.

The BHF say that stress is not a direct risk factor for cardiovascular disease, but it may contribute to your risk level. The stressful nature of teachers' lives may well make us more susceptible to the UK's biggest killer - heart disease.

Lawrence has recovered - thanks to the tremendous work of both the ambulance crew who got him to hospital so quickly and the staff at St.George's in Tooting. However, he knows that it was a close-call.

Lawrence has been one of those invaluable colleagues who are always ready to help others around him. A donation is also a small way to thank Lawrence, and colleagues like him, for the work that they do for others.
